**Ticket: Mudlark ingest service is flooding logs again**

The ingest pods are emitting ~40k debug lines a minute, which is drowning out actual errors. Proposal: turn on the 1-in-100 sampler for the parse-ok path and keep failures at full volume. Support folks, heads up — counts in dashboards will look lower. Repro trace is attached below.

trace token, fafog-kageg: htk4_98e6

**Ticket DRIFT-207: Monthly partitioning drift on Ferndock analytics DB**

So, quick one for review: the `events_raw` table on Ferndock prod is supposed to auto-create monthly partitions two months ahead, but someone tweaked the scheduler on the replica and now staging and prod disagree on partition boundaries. No data loss, but retention jobs are dropping the wrong months on staging — flagging for security sign-off since it touches data deletion. We want to restore the approved settings everywhere. The intended configuration is listed below.

deployment values, yadug-bawif:
[framir]
team = pelox
access_code = ac_a38ab2
owner = tamion.julael
host = framir.tolvaqlabs.test
port = 11211
peer = tammir.zemvargrid.local
salt = 2215ef03
pin = 1541

Rebalancer runbook — Spokewise tool. If the van-dispatch queue stalls, check the station-capacity feed first; stale feeds make the solver loop forever. Kill the solver pod, purge the queue, restart. Never edit dock counts by hand in prod — the Thornquay ops team owns that table. Solver runs are idempotent, so a double restart is safe. Every incident note must cite the run's trace token, which appears below.

pipeline stamp: htk4_ae36

// On-call note: the Quartzline client below sometimes fails with
// NXDOMAIN on first connect. Root cause: flaky resolution of the
// internal resolver in the Hollowpine cluster — it drops the first
// query under load. Workaround: retries=3 with 200ms backoff, already
// set below. Do NOT switch to the public resolver; Quartzline is
// internal-only. If retries exhaust, restart the sidecar, not the app.
// Auth is a static key for the Quartzline API, pasted on the next line.

API key for yahig-tadup: kto7_ubizbYm